Factors Affecting Sushi Delivery Speed

As the demand for sushi delivery continues to rise, the speed and efficiency of delivery services have become crucial factors in determining customer satisfaction. However, various factors can impact the speed of sushi delivery, affecting not only customer experience but also the reputation of sushi restaurants.

The factors influencing sushi delivery speed are multifaceted, including location, traffic, order complexity, and logistics. A comprehensive understanding of these factors is essential for sushi restaurants to optimize their delivery operations.

Location: The Geography of Sushi Delivery

The location of both the sushi restaurant and the customer plays a significant role in determining delivery speed. Proximity and accessibility are crucial factors in ensuring timely delivery. A location that is centrally situated, with easy access to major transportation routes, can significantly reduce delivery times.

In urban areas, sushi restaurants located in densely populated neighborhoods can benefit from shorter delivery routes and increased accessibility. Conversely, restaurants situated in suburban or rural areas may face longer distances and reduced accessibility, leading to slower delivery times.

Traffic: The Unpredictable Factor

Traffic congestion is a significant obstacle in sushi delivery, particularly during peak hours or special events. Sushi restaurants must take into account the likelihood of traffic congestion when scheduling deliveries to minimize delays.

Effective route planning and real-time traffic updates can help mitigate the impact of traffic on delivery times. Additionally, partnering with local transportation services or delivery companies that offer real-time traffic monitoring can further optimize delivery routes.

Order Complexity: The Art of Balancing Speed and Quality

The complexity of orders can also impact delivery speed. Sushi restaurants that offer a wide variety of menu items or customize orders to meet specific customer preferences may face increased delivery times. This is particularly true for orders involving multiple ingredients, special requests, or high-demand items.

To balance speed and quality, sushi restaurants can implement strategies such as order grouping, streamlined menu offerings, or dedicated staff members for complex orders.

Logistics: The Backbone of Sushi Delivery

Efficient logistics are essential for maintaining high-quality sushi delivery. Sushi restaurants must manage their stock, inventory, and supply chain effectively to ensure that ingredients and menu items are available when needed.

Effective logistics also involve managing staff and equipment to optimize delivery operations. This includes allocating sufficient staff for peak periods, investing in delivery equipment, and maintaining communication with customers and delivery staff.

Trade-Offs: Balancing Speed and Quality

Sushi restaurants often face trade-offs between fast delivery and maintaining high-quality sushi. Prioritizing speed may compromise on the quality of the dish, while prioritizing quality may lead to slower delivery times.

To address this trade-off, sushi restaurants can invest in efficient logistics, develop strategic menu offerings, or implement quality control measures to ensure consistency in their dishes.

The Potential of Sushi Delivery as a Sustainable Food Option

As the world grapples with the consequences of climate change, the need for sustainable food options has never been more pressing. With the rise of meal delivery services, the sushi industry is poised to play a significant role in reducing its environmental impact. However, the current state of sushi delivery is often marred by excessive packaging, high transportation emissions, and energy-intensive operations.

The Alarming Truth: The Environmental Impact of Sushi Delivery

The production, distribution, and consumption of sushi delivery have a significant environmental footprint. According to a study published in the Journal of Food Science, the average sushi meal delivery generates 1.5 kg of CO2 equivalent emissions per serving, mostly due to transportation and packaging (1). This staggering figure highlights the urgent need for sustainable sushi delivery practices.

  • Packaging Waste: Single-use plastics, Styrofoam containers, and other disposable packaging materials contribute significantly to the environmental impact of sushi delivery. These materials often end up in landfills or oceans, harming marine life and ecosystems.
  • Transportation Emissions: The constant flow of deliveries generates substantial emissions from vehicles, which exacerbate air pollution and contribute to climate change.
  • Energy Consumption: Sushi restaurants and meal delivery services often rely on intensive energy sources, such as gas and electricity, to power their operations. This energy usage contributes to greenhouse gas emissions and climate change.

The Path Forward: Sustainable Sushi Delivery Solutions

Fortunately, innovative solutions are emerging to mitigate the environmental impact of sushi delivery. By incorporating sustainable practices, sushi restaurants and meal delivery services can reduce their carbon footprint, improve profitability, and enhance customer loyalty.

  • Eco-Friendly Packaging: Switching to compostable or biodegradable packaging materials can significantly reduce waste and minimize the environmental impact of sushi delivery.
  • Electric or Hybrid Vehicles: Adopting environmentally friendly transportation methods, such as electric or hybrid vehicles, can lower emissions and reduce reliance on fossil fuels.
  • Wind and Solar Power: Investing in renewable energy sources like wind and solar power can reduce energy consumption and dependence on non-renewable energy.
  • Reduced Food Waste: Implementing effective food waste reduction strategies, such as meal planning and inventory management, can minimize waste and reduce energy consumption.
